Blind Drunk!
Thursday 16 March 2017
The ‘blind’ tasting of low and high priced wines was one I had been excited about for a long time. I shall repeat the evening again so this will be a short article and hence the SPOILER alert. The concept is easy but great for learning and great for fun: 1. take 8 bottles of wine (4 whites, 4 reds); hide in ‘blind’ tasting bags; pour, taste and evaluate; discuss style, variety, price and preference; reveal, and enjoy!
